Salli Richardson and Husband Dondre Whitfield Welcome a Baby Boy

Salli Richardson and Dondre Whitfield's second child is a baby boy, who is named Dre Terrell Whitfield.

Salli Richardson has given birth to a baby boy, her second child with actor husband Dondre Whitfield, back on Saturday, January 24. The infant, named Dre Terrell Whitfield, weighing in at 7 lbs., 7 oz at time of birth.

Dre joins Salli and Dondre's eldest child, daughter Parker Richardson Whitfield. Salli and Dondre themselves have been married since September 8, 2002.

Salli Richardson rose to stardom for her role as Allison Blake in "Eureka", an NBC Universal's dramedy TV series which she still stars in until present time. She additionally also has some starring roles in big screen movies, like "I Am Legend" and "Antwone Fisher".

Dondre Whitfield, meanwhile, gained his first acting notoriety on the sitcom "The Cosby Show", portraying the role of Robert Foreman. His other TV credits include "All My Children" and "Ghost Whisperer".
